Tomcat配置为服务
2016年9月26日
14:16
最重要的要点
必备知识1:chkconfig:配置系统服务
必备知识2:systemctl:系统服务管理指令
1.复制catalina.sh到/ect/init.d/文件夹下,并修该文件名称为tomcat8
cd /home/zs/software/apache-tomcat-8.0.37/bin/ |
#跳转到tomcat8的bin目录下 |
cp catalina.sh /etc/init.d/ |
#复制到/etc/init.d文件夹下; 如果提示权限不够,则在该命令前 加sudo |
mv catalina.sh tomcat8 |
#重名名为tomcat |
2.添加服务所需信息
chmod 777 tomcat8 |
#给该文件添加权限 |
|
#不管你用什么方法,你需要: 1.添加chkconfig及description到这个文件中 2.指定CATALINA_HOME和JAVA_HOME 3.下面使用VI编辑器进行处理 |
vi tomcat8 |
#使用VI编辑器打开 |
i |
#使用VI编辑器插入模式 |
CATALINA_HOME=/home/zs/software/apache-tomcat-8.0.37 JAVA_HOME=/usr/lib/jvm/java |
#加入CATALINA_HOME和JAVA_HOME |
#chkconfig: 2345 10 90 #description: tomcat8 service |
#配置服务说所需信息,这里配置是2345这4个运行级别,所以会开机自启动,10是启动优先级,90是关闭优先级,优先级的值为0-99,越小优先级越高 |
3.使用chkconfig--add添加到服务
chkconfig --add tomcat8 |
#添加服务 |
chkconfig --list |
#查看服务列表 如果2,3,4,5都是on状态,则会开机自启动 |
chkconfig --del tomcat8 |
#删除服务 |
4.使用service命令启动、关闭
service tomcat8 start |
#启动Tomcat8 |
service tomcat8 stop |
#关闭Tomcat8 |
参考